Common SoV.exe Errors on Windows

Encountering errors associated with SoV.exe can be frustrating. These errors may vary in nature and can surface due to different reasons, such as software conflicts, outdated drivers, or even malware infections. Below, we've outlined the most commonly reported errors linked to SoV.exe, to aid in understanding and potentially resolving the issues at hand.

  • SoV.exe File Not Executing: This error message indicates that the system is unable to run the executable file. This could be due to issues like corrupted file data, incorrect file permissions, or system resource limitations.
  • Error 0xc0000005: This warning appears when the system encounters an access violation problem. This could be due to issues with memory, malware affecting the system, or drivers that need updating.
  • Missing SoV.exe File: This alert comes up when the system is unable to locate the necessary executable file. SoV.exe could have been removed, relocated, or the provided file path might be incorrect.
  • Application Not Found: This message occurs when the system can't find the necessary application. Possible reasons could be the application being deleted, moved, or an inaccurately specified file path.
  • Blue Screen of Death (BSOD): Although not strictly an SoV.exe error, certain .exe files can cause system instability leading to a BSOD, indicating a fatal system error.

How to Remove SoV.exe

Should you need to remove the SoV.exe file from your system, please proceed with the following steps. As always, exercise caution when modifying system files, as inadvertent changes can sometimes lead to unexpected system behavior.

  1. Identify the file location: The first step is to find where SoV.exe resides on your computer. You can do this by right-clicking the file (if visible) and choosing Properties or searching for it in the File Explorer.

  2. Backup your data: Before making any changes, ensure you have a backup of important data. This way, if something goes wrong, you can restore your data.

  3. Delete the file: Once you've located SoV.exe, right-click on it and select Delete. This will move the file to the Recycle Bin.

  4. Empty the Recycle Bin: After deleting SoV.exe, don't forget to empty the Recycle Bin to remove the file from your system completely. Right-click on the Recycle Bin and select Empty Recycle Bin.

  5. Scan your system: After removing the file, running a full system scan with a trusted antivirus tool is a good idea. This will help ensure no leftover file pieces or other potential threats.

Note: Remember, if SoV.exe is part of a sprogram, removing this file may affect the application's functionality. If issues arise after the deletion, consider reinstalling the software or seek assistance from a tech professional.
